The “CBS Evening News with Katie Couric” featured a story about Cris Dopher, a 37-year-old with CF, who had a goal to finish the New York City marathon. Dopher, in fact, finished the race: “It feels really good at those moments just to be able to run free,” he said.
The memory of people he knew who died of CF kept him motivated during the last few miles, Dopher said.
The CBS story highlighted the remarkable progress underway in treating CF and how increasing numbers of people with the disease are now growing into adulthood. The median predicted age of survival has reached an all-time high of 37.4.
